Repair Procedures: Installation

  1. Check that the shift lever is placed in the "N" position.
  2. Install the inhibitor switch (A).
    NOTE: Lightly tighten the inhibitor switch mounting bolts so that necessary adjustments can be made.
    Fig 1: Locating Inhibitor Switch
    G12163562Courtesy of KIA MOTORS AMERICA, INC.
  3. Install the manual control lever (A).
    NOTE: Lightly tighten the manual control lever nut so that necessary adjustments can be made.
    Fig 2: Locating Manual Control Lever
    G12163563Courtesy of KIA MOTORS AMERICA, INC.
  4. Align the hole (B) in the manual control lever with the "N" position hole (A) of the inhibitor switch and then insert the SST inhibitor switch guide pin (09480-A3800).
    Fig 3: Inserting SST Inhibitor Switch Guide Pin (09480-A3800)
    G12163564Courtesy of KIA MOTORS AMERICA, INC.
  5. Tighten the manual lever mounting nut (A) to the specified torque.

    Tightening torque: 

    17.7 - 24.5 N.m (1.8 - 2.5 kgf.m, 13.0 - 18.1 lb.ft)

  6. Tighten the inhibitor switch mounting bolts (B) to the specified torque.

    Tightening torque: 

    9.8 - 11.8 N.m (1.0 - 1.2 kgf.m, 7.2 - 8.7 lb.ft)

    Fig 4: Locating Inhibitor Switch Mounting Bolts And Manual Lever Mounting Nut
    G12163565Courtesy of KIA MOTORS AMERICA, INC.
  7. Remove the SST (09480-A3800) from the adjustment hole.
  8. Connect the inhibitor switch connector (A).
    Fig 5: Locating Inhibitor Switch Connector
    G12163566Courtesy of KIA MOTORS AMERICA, INC.
  9. Tighten the nut (A) loosely.
    NOTE: Lightly tighten the nut so that necessary adjustments can be made.
    Fig 6: Locating Shift Cable Nut
    G12163567Courtesy of KIA MOTORS AMERICA, INC.
  10. Tighten the nut (A) to the specified torque after removing free play by pushing the shift cable in the direction of the arrow.

    Tightening torque: 

    9.8 - 14.7 N.m (1.0 - 1.5 kgf.m, 7.2 - 10.8 lb.ft)

    Fig 7: Pushing Shift Cable
    G12163568Courtesy of KIA MOTORS AMERICA, INC.
  11. Install the battery and battery tray.

    (Refer to Engine Electrical System - "BATTERY ")
